How search engines determine website rankings?
- Karolina Kroliczek
- 4 days ago
- 3 min read
Having a website is just the beginning, you might have heard this sentence multiple times! The real challenge lies in ensuring that your site can be found among the vast number of other websites on the internet. Search engines, such as Google, Bing, and Yahoo use complex algorithms to determine the ranking of websites in search results. This ranking decides which sites appear at the top when a user searches for specific keywords or phrases. Let’s delve into how search engines determine website rankings and what you can do to improve yours!
The importance of website rankings
Website rankings are crucial for online visibility. A high ranking means more traffic, which often translates to more potential customers or readers. According to studies, sites that appear on the first page of search results receive 75% of clicks, while those on the second page get significantly less.
Understanding how rankings work can empower website owners. It can help you optimize your site effectively, ensuring it reaches your target audience. There are numerous factors that affect website rankings and knowing them can provide you with a clear path to success.

Key factors influencing website rankings
Search engines utilise various factors to decide your website’s ranking. Here are some of the most significant ones:
1. Content quality and relevance
High-quality content is the backbone of any successful website. Search engines favor sites that provide useful, engaging and relevant content to users. When creating content, consider the following:
Keyword research: identify the keywords your target audience uses and incorporate them naturally within your content.
Comprehensive information: cover topics thoroughly and provide value. Articles with in-depth information tend to rank higher.
Freshness: regularly update your content and add new posts. Outdated information can hurt your rankings.
2. Backlinks
Backlinks act as votes of confidence from one website to another. When respected websites link to your content, search engines view this as an indication of your site's authority and relevance. Here are some tips to gain quality backlinks:
Guest blogging: write guest posts for reputable websites in your niche.
Create shareable infographics: compelling visuals often get shared and linked to other sites.
Engage in community forums: becoming an active participant in forums and discussions can lead to backlinks when others reference your insights.

3. User experience (UX)
A positive user experience can greatly influence your website’s ranking. Search engines assess user interactions, so make sure your website is:
Mobile-friendly: With more users accessing the web on mobile devices, a responsive design is essential.
Fast loading: Page speed significantly impacts user satisfaction and can affect rankings.
Easy navigation: Organise your website with clear menus and intuitive layouts to enhance user experience.
4. On-page SEO
On-page SEO refers to the practices you implement directly on your website. This can significantly influence rankings. Here are key elements to consider:
Title tags: create unique and descriptive title tags for each page.
Meta descriptions: write compelling meta descriptions to increase click-through rates from search results.
Header tags: use proper header tags (H1, H2, H3) to structure your content, making it easy for search engines to read and understand.
5. Technical SEO
Technical SEO encompasses optimising your website’s backend to facilitate crawling and indexing by search engines. Important aspects include:
XML sitemaps: create an XML sitemap to guide search engines through your site structure.
Robots.txt: use the robots.txt file to inform search engines which pages to crawl.
Structured data markup: implement structured data to enhance your search listings with rich snippets.
For those seriously interested in improving their google search ranking, addressing technical aspects is paramount.

Monitoring your website’s performance
Monitoring your site's performance is essential for understanding what works and what needs improvement. Various tools can help you analyse your website rankings and metrics:
Google Analytics: use to track traffic, user behavior and conversion rates.
Google Search Console: you can gain insights about how your site appears in searches, identify crawl issues and monitor performance.
SEO Tools: use tools like SEMrush or Ahrefs which can provide comprehensive analytics of SEO keywords, backlinks and your competitors.
Final thoughts on achieving better SEO rankings
Improving website rankings is not an overnight task. It requires consistent effort and a commitment to providing quality content and a strong user experience. Emphasising factors like content relevance, backlinks, technical SEO and monitoring tools can yield significant results over time.
Finally, remember to stay informed about the latest trends and algorithm changes in search engines to adapt your strategies effectively!
